The Powers of the BrevilleJuice Fountain Elite 800JEXL

The Breville 800JEXL Juice Fountain Elite 1000-Watt Juice Extractor, as that’s its full name – is quite an interesting machine in many ways. This is a surprisingly powerful juicer which, as one reviewer on the net points out, could probably do well on the side as a wood chipper. As a result, it won’t protest against even the hardest vegetables, which is a big plus for me. I’ve tried several juicers before where you had to cut up for example carrots into smaller pieces, which obviously takes a lot of extra time. With this juicing machine I never encountered this problem – just pump in the produce and watch the juice come out.

Apart from this, it’s also powerful enough to stand being used for a really long duration. In one of my tests I made bulk juice by running it over five hours in one go, and it didn’t say a peep in protest. So if you’re going to make a lot of juice at once – or for that matter if you’re going to use it several times a day for smaller portions – this is the one for you.

Pros and Cons of a Breville 800JEXL Juicer

Another plus side is the big feed tube measuring at 3’’, which makes it easy to pump in a lot of vegetables or fruits in no time. But along with this there’s also a little something that might make some people stay away – this machine is big. Unfortunately, it’s big enough to maybe scare away some people, especially apartment owners with small kitchen space. On the other side, I do think it’s worth its space considering what it actually does for your kitchen. It’s a powerful machine that needs its space, and unless you’re already really desperate for kitchen space I would say it’s worth it.
